gpt4 book ai didi

scp - scp 无法访问 freeSSHD

转载 作者:行者123 更新时间:2023-12-04 12:08:13 29 4
gpt4 key购买 nike

我在 Windows A 上运行 freeSSHD,需要通过 scp 传输文件。运行 freesshd 的 Windows 可以通过 ssh 客户端连接。但是 Windows 上的 WinSCP 和 Linux 上的 scp 都无法使用 freeSSHD 连接到 Windows。错误是:

在 Linux 上:

test@workstation:~$ scp -r /home/test/scptest test@192.168.91.238:/C:\Users\dejavu\Desktop
test@192.168.91.238's password:
exec request failed on channel 0
lost connection

在 window 上:

选择“scp”协议(protocol)传输文件,端口默认为 22。
错误只是 host is not communicating for more than 15 seconds. still waiting...

最佳答案

scp和其他许多东西一样,是双向协议(protocol)。它需要 scp出现在客户端和服务器上。当您发出复制命令时,ssh连接到给定的服务器并生成 scp过程,您本地的scp然后与之通信。在您的情况下,没有 scp在服务器上,因此无法进行通信。
rsync行为方式完全相同。

我想在你的情况下你可以试试 sftp .

关于scp - scp 无法访问 freeSSHD,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/22624881/

29 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com